本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。
查看通知规则目标
您可以使用开发工具控制台而不是 Amazon SNS 控制台查看 AWS 区域中所有资源的所有通知规则目标。您也可以查看通知规则目标的详细信息。
查看通知规则目标(控制台)
打开 https://console.aws.amazon.com/codesuite/settings/notifications
上的 AWS 开发工具控制台。 -
在导航栏中,展开设置,然后选择通知规则。
-
在 Notification rule targets(通知规则目标)中,查看您当前登录的 AWS 区域的 AWS 账户中的通知规则所使用的目标列表。使用选择器更改 AWS 区域。如果目标状态显示为 Unreachable (无法访问),您可能需要进行调查。有关更多信息,请参阅问题排查 。
查看通知规则目标的列表 (AWS CLI)
-
在终端或命令提示符处,运行 list-targets 命令可查看指定的 AWS 区域的所有通知规则目标的列表:
aws codestar-notifications list-targets --region
us-east-2
-
如果成功,此命令将为 AWS 区域中的每个通知规则返回 ID 和 ARN,类似于以下内容:
{ "Targets": [ { "TargetAddress": "arn:aws:sns:us-east-2:
123456789012
:MySNSTopicForNotificationRules
", "TargetType": "SNS", "TargetStatus": "ACTIVE" }, { "TargetAddress": "arn:aws:chatbot::123456789012
:chat-configuration/slack-channel/MySlackChannelClientForMyDevTeam
", "TargetStatus": "ACTIVE", "TargetType": "AWSChatbotSlack" }, { "TargetAddress": "arn:aws:sns:us-east-2:123456789012
:MySNSTopicForNotificationsAboutMyDemoRepo
", "TargetType": "SNS", "TargetStatus": "ACTIVE" } ] }